ABSTRACT:
In the art of making chemically embossed sheets of resinous material for use as floor, wall, desk and table coverings, a method of salvaging and recovering a backing sheet material and a potentially foamable, gelled plastisol composition on which has been improperly or inaccurately applied a printing ink composition containing an anhydride having blow-modifying properties which comprises: (1) treating the printing ink composition and the potentially foamable, gelled plastisol composition with a neutralizing, inhibiting or negating composition capable of destroying or rendering substantially ineffectual the blow-modifying properties of the anhdride without destroying or rendering ineffectual the blowing and foaming properties of the potentially foamable, gelled plastisol composition; (2) reprinting the potentially foamable, gelled plastisol composition with another printing ink composition containing a blow-modifier; and (3) blowing or foaming the potentially foamable, gelled plastisol composition, whereby chemically embossed effects are obtained as a result of the blow-modifying properties of the blow-modifier used in the reprinting process, rather than the blow-modifier used in the initial printing process.
